Christian Church Resumes Services

From the Capital-Journal:
The Rev. Caleb Falk said Rossville Christian Church was able to quickly mount an online presentation that included live music and preaching. The church, which has a normal attendance of about 100, has resumed meeting, with slightly fewer than normal attending.
“It was great to finally be back in person,” Falk said. “It was good to see everybody and to be back together, and not just preaching to and singing to a camera.”
Falk said the Rossville church will continue streaming its services for the next several weeks, but that isn’t something it plans to carry on long term. He said the building has ample space for social distancing but the church hasn’t resumed a lot of the programs it normally offers.
“We’re kind of having to play it by ear,” Falk said about getting back to normal. “It’s hard to say how things are going to progress. This situation is constantly changing and adapting.”
